This training will allow you to learn to detect your sources of stage fright and optimize your speech.
Objectives:
- Structuring ones public speaking
- Acquiring technics to handle stress
- Improving ones performance during public speaking
Program:
I. Identifying ones functioning during Public Speaking situation
- Qualities, difficulties, improvement axis
- Self assessment: What kind of communicator are you ?
- Video viewing
II. Public Speaking key principles
- Body “forms, deforms and transforms the speech”
- Communication is enriched by gestures
- Look, face and voice reinforce communication
III. Stage fright: friend or enemy ?
- Stage fright reasons: psychological barriers, inoperative schemes, cultural barriers
- Relativizing: 4 questions to asks oneself
- Stage fright taming to make it an ally
IV. Public Speaking preparation
- Understanding to be understood
- Public Speaking stucturing
V. Successful Public Speaking on D-Day
- Getting ready on D-Day
- Capturing and keeping attention
- Getting public interested and motivated
- Using rhythms, silences and accentuations
- Disturbing behaviors and how to handle them
